What Are Prefilled Pods? Simple Explanation & Background

Prefilled pods are small, sealed cartridges already filled with e-liquid—usually offered in a wide range of flavours and nicotine levels. These pods easily snap into a reusable vape battery. Once you’ve finished a pod, you just pop in a new one and keep going. No spills, no swapping coils, no headaches—just click and vape. The design keeps the liquid locked inside, so you never handle the juice directly. Prefilled pods have roots in early e-cigs called cartomizers but now include advanced mesh coils for much better vapour, flavor, and overall satisfaction.

From Early E-Cigs to Today

  • The First Wave: 2009–2015 brought stick-shaped e-cigs and simple pod kits to the market.
  • Development of Refillable Pods: These became popular for people who wanted more control, but they involved upkeep and refilling.
  • Modern Prefilled Pods: These combine high-tech features with no-fuss usability, a big reason for their growth as disposables get phased out and people look for greener options.

Clearing Up Misunderstandings About Prefilled Pods

  • Are prefilled pods just for new users?
    Not at all. Many experienced vapers like the portability and speed of prefilled pods for when traveling or at work since they’re so discreet.
  • Can you refill a closed pod?
    No. Pods are sealed to prevent tampering or leaks. Forcing them open can break them and invalidates warranties.
  • How long does a battery last?
    A good pod kit battery may work for a day or more between charges, and you just switch out the pod when needed—the battery itself can serve for many weeks.

Understanding German Vape Laws: Quick Guide

Germany’s rules match those found across the European Union for safer vaping:

  • Only 2ml of vape juice, maximum, is allowed per pod, along with 20mg/ml nicotine.
  • Advertising is very limited and aimed at adults—not allowed online, with few exceptions for consumer info.
  • Sealed, child-proof packaging and health warnings are necessary.
  • Most traditional, fruit, and dessert flavours are legal inside Germany, but local law changes are always a possibility. Double-check whenever you buy.
  • You need to be 18 or older to buy, and extra rules apply on bringing vapes across borders.
